4.How long does it take to get your medical assistant bachelor’s degree online?

In general, most students can complete a accredited medical assistant bachelor’s degree online in four years or less. However, there are a number of factors that can impact the length of time it takes to earn your degree.

The first is the type of program you choose. Some schools offer accelerated programs that allow you to complete your degree in as little as two years. If you choose a traditional four-year program, you’ll need to factor in time for summer break and any holidays when classes are not in session.

Another factor that can impact the length of time it takes to earn your medical assistant bachelor’s degree online is your prior academic record. If you have already completed some college coursework, you may be able to transfer credits and graduate in less time than it would take someone who is starting from scratch.

Additionally, the number of courses you take each semester can also affect how long it takes to earn your degree. If you’re able to take more courses each term, you’ll be able to complete your degree more quickly. Conversely, if you can only handle a few courses at a time due to work or family obligations, it will take longer to complete your medical assistant bachelor’s degree online.

5.What are the courses you’ll take for your medical assistant bachelor’s degree online?

Most medical assistant bachelor’s degree programs will take four years to complete, although some accelerated programs may be available. During your first two years, you’ll likely take general education courses such as English, math, and sciences. In your remaining two years, you’ll take mostly medical-related courses such as anatomy and physiology, medical ethics, and healthcare administration. Some bachelor’s degree programs also allow you to complete a clinical externship to get real-world experience in the field.

7.What are the job prospects for Medical assistants with a bachelor’s degree?

Although the Bureau of Labor Statistics projects strong job growth in the medical assisting field through 2024, Medical Assistants with a bachelor’s degree may find they have an advantage over those without a degree when vying for the most attractive positions. Many employers prefer to hire medical assistants who have a bachelor’s degree, and some positions may be closed to candidates without one. In addition, medical assistants with a bachelor’s degree may be eligible for management-level positions or supervisory roles. The median annual salary for medical assistants was $31,540 in 2016, according to the BLS.
